  • Title

    Effect of enamel covering of copper conductors in paper oil insulation of transformers

  • Abstract
    Failure of transformers and reactors due to sulphur in transformer oil is reported in literature. The sulphur in oil by chemical reaction with copper produces copper sulphide which alters the electric field. One of the mitigation techniques followed by manufacturers is replacement of bare copper conductors with enameled copper conductors. In this study, an attempt is made to understand field distribution in transformer insulation due to enamel on the conductor. Finite Element Method (FEM) has been used to understand the electric field distribution in paper and oil with enamel on copper conductor.
